INS110H1: Introduction to Conversational Anishinaabemowin

36L

This course will introduce students to Anishinaabemowin, the language of the Anishinaabe people (an Indigenous people of the Great Lakes), with a focus on greetings and basic conversation. The course is highly interactive and will engage students in dialogues that reflect real-life uses while also introducing them to nuances in how the language functions in different settings. This course is intended to give students some speaking skills along with an appreciation for the importance of the language to Anishinaabe communities. While the course is appropriate for Indigenous Studies majors, it is accessible to students from other units as well.
